Transaction 6c8072642e63456f2e116cafc3fbd6f6c1fda13340602a70b577a2a76cf87e8d

7 Input
1 Outputs
  • 6c8072642e63456f2e116cafc3fbd6f6c1fda13340602a70b577a2a76cf87e8d:0
  • value  7834249
    address  3Lkk9XTiojBBY3qoYzDdrH9AMRmBewwpMY